I had two experiences with Potentiate. Both were unprofessional ..
First one was in November 2021. I applied for the senior CX account manager role and was initially interviewed by the hiring manager by phone and then via MS teams. The role was really interesting with their team working with the automotive clients in Australia and I saw my skills being applied in the role with a potential for growth. The third interview was with the hiring manager and another team member which also went well. Then the HR person reached out and advised me that they will try to set up a meeting with the head of research which will be the final round unless theres a final task required. There was a gap of 2-3 weeks where the HR or the hiring manager did not reply at all. I kept waiting for the final round interview as advised and declined couple of other offers as I was really interested in the role. After 3-4 weeks, I followed up with the hiring manager again and was advised that they already recruited someone in the past month while keeping me waiting for the last round of interview.
I started a 6 months contract with another firm and once it ended, Potentiate was one of the companies I checked again if they had any roles. I connected with one of the hiring managers who had an initial phone call with me followed by two meetings with MS teams, and another call from the hiring manager asking as a follow up. There was a question about salary and I told him I was OK to negotiate because I am really interested in the role.
A week or so later, I got a call from their new HR manager and I was advised to stay put as the next interview will be with their head of research. Then there was a gap of another month and I kept following up with the hiring manager on the progress as I felt that both the hiring manager and I connected well and we were on the same page with regards to the role, the requirements and how my skills would add value.
A month later, history repeated itself. I got a mail from the HR that they had already recruited someone. This is when they kept me waiting for the final round interview with their head of research again. What's worse, they forwarded me some other candidate's email chain where they are corresponding to setting up appointments and follow-ups for their last round of interviews, and tacked on a response to me on top of that saying that my interview process will not be progressing further.
A found the whole process to be a bit unprofessional when after completing 2-3 rounds of interviews, advising me that my next interview is with their head of research and they will come back to me with the dates, then there is complete silence for 3-4 weeks and after following up with them multiple times, I would get a response saying they will not be progressing with me.
Why keep me waiting for weeks saying they will schedule my interview with their head of research, when they did not want to progress with me? Very unprofessional!
